The increasing elderly population in Japan and Indonesia increases the risk of powerlessness in residents of care facilities such as Rojinhome Ikedaen. This case study aims to describe nursing care for Mrs. Y with powerlessness through the process of assessment, diagnosis, intervention, implementation, and evaluation for 3x24 hours. The type of research is a qualitative descriptive case study with a nursing process approach. The population of the elderly in the Finesu room (20 people), a single purposive sample of Mrs. Y (92 years old, diabetes). Instruments include assessment sheets (MMSE, social interaction), interviews, observations; thematic analysis with triangulation. The results showed a diagnosis of powerlessness (D.0092) related to unsatisfactory interpersonal interactions; coping promotion intervention (I.09312) increased interaction interest from 2 to 5 and social participation. Conclusion: Stepwise nursing care is effective in reducing initial powerlessness, a continuous protocol for full independence is recommended.
